// Disable printf override in common/forbidden.h to avoid
|
||||
// clashes with pspdebug.h from the PSP SDK.
|
||||
// That header file uses
|
||||
// __attribute__((format(printf,1,2)));
|
||||
// which gets messed up by our override mechanism; this could
|
||||
// be avoided by either changing the PSP SDK to use the equally
|
||||
// legal and valid
|
||||
// __attribute__((format(__printf__,1,2)));
|
||||
// or by refining our printf override to use a varadic macro
|
||||
// (which then wouldn't be portable, though).
|
||||
// Anyway, for now we just disable the printf override globally
|
||||
// for the PSP port
|
||||
#define FORBIDDEN_SYMBOL_EXCEPTION_printf
